      India ranked 112 in the 2019 WEFs Gender Gap Report. India ranked 112th on the World Economic Forum's Gender Gap Report 2019. The report listed 153 nations in terms of the gap between genders. India was among the bottom five for women's health and survival and economic participation. India secured 108th rank in 2018. The list was topped Iceland.

      The status of gender equality in Mongolia is quite unique and complex. In the World Economic Forum’s 2018 Gender Gap Report, Mongolia ranked 58th out of the 144 countries studied and 5th among other countries within the Asia Pacific region.

      In 2019, women accounted for 46% of appointments to Commonwealth Government boards across Australia (Gender Indicators Australia, Nov. 2019, ABS). By early 2018, 53% of paid public board positions in Victoria were held by women (Safe and Strong: A Victorian Gender Equality Strategy Achievements Report Year One, Victorian Government, 2019).
